About The Role
As a Senior QA Automation Engineer – Playwright/Selenium, you will make an impact by designing, developing, and implementing scalable test automation solutions that improve software quality, accelerate release cycles, and enhance customer experiences. You will be a valued member of the Quality Engineering team and work collaboratively with Developers, Business Analysts, Product Owners, DevOps Engineers, and other stakeholders to ensure the delivery of high-quality applications.
Responsibilities
- Design, develop, and maintain robust automated test frameworks using Playwright, Selenium, TypeScript, and Java.
- Create and execute functional, integration, regression, and end-to-end test solutions across multiple applications and platforms.
- Integrate automated test suites into CI/CD pipelines to enable continuous testing and support rapid software delivery.
- Analyze test execution results, identify defects, and partner with development teams to drive timely issue resolution.
- Enhance automation coverage, maintain reusable test assets, and continuously improve testing processes, quality metrics, and engineering best practices.
Requirements
- 7+ years of strong experience in test automation using Playwright and/or Selenium.
- Hands-on programming experience with Java and TypeScript.
- Proven experience in functional testing, regression testing, and test case design and execution.
- Experience developing and maintaining scalable automation frameworks for web applications.
- Strong understanding of software testing methodologies, defect management, and quality assurance best practices.
- Experience collaborating within Agile software development environments.
- Excellent analytical, troubleshooting, and communication skills.
